
| Hunting Tournament Rules BENEFIT OBJECTIVE: All game donated during the benefit will be given to The Salvation Army. All canned goods will be donated to the local Emporia food bank. Proceeds from entry fees will benefit the Beau Arndt “Love of the Outdoors” Scholarship at Emporia State University and Camp Alexander in Emporia Kansas. . PARTICIPATION AND ELIGIBILITY: Participation is open to anyone 18 years or older. Minors are eligible to participate with a parent or legal guardian signature on the entry/waiver form. A completed entry form/waiver, and all entry fees must be received before you are eligible to enter the benefit. ENTRY FEES/PAYBACK: $50 plus 10 canned goods or a new toy. 1ST place $500, 2nd place $400, 3rd place $300. These amounts are based on the number of teams entered. TEAMS: Teams consist of 2 hunters. All members of a team must be registered to compete. REGISTRATION: 7:00pm – 8:00pm Friday, December (date to be announced later) at the Anderson Building, Fairgrounds, Emporia, Kansas. You do not have to be at the meeting, but it is strongly recommended. All team entry forms and payment must be received no later than Friday, December (date to be announced later) at 8:00pm. LEGAL REQUIREMENTS: 1) Must have a valid hunting license and permits according to State and Federal regulations. 2) All State and Federal regulations, including, but not limited to; shooting light, possession limit, permission, animal identification, and proper hunting etiquette must be followed at all times. 3) Anyone caught cheating will be disqualified. Anyone breaking laws will be subject to prosecution by the appropriate law enforcement agencies. 4) Must have a fur harvesters license to check in any fur bearer except coyote. CHECK-IN: 1) Final Check-In for ALL teams will be at 12:00pm Sunday, December (date to be announced later), at the fairgrounds, in Emporia Kansas. 2) All teams must provide their team cards and deer tickets, if used, at check-in. Once team cards are turned in, your bag limits are final. 3) Cleaning stations will be provided to clean game and furs. 4) There will be judges at check-in evaluating quality and care of meat. All final results will be established by the judges. Any questionable furs or inedible meat will not be accepted, nor points accounted for. 5) NO frozen game or furs will be admitted into the competition. However, any meat from previous hunts will be accepted for donations! Upland Bird Care: 1) All birds must be cleaned. 2) No Frozen birds allowed. 3) Must have leg, wing or plumage for identification purposes. Water Fowl: 1) We will only accept puddle ducks. 2) All birds must be cleaned. 3) No frozen birds allowed. 4) Must have leg, wing, or plumage for identification purposes. Fur Care: 1) No mangy animals allowed. 2) Please do not bring in immature furbearers. 3) All furs must be at least green skinned, except for coyotes Deer Care: 1) All deer must be field dressed. 2) All deer must be checked in at a KFFH participating state processors. (a list is provided in your packet) 3) Deer ticket must be filled out at processor, and signed. 4) Deer tickets need to be turned in at check-in to receive points. PENALTIES: 1)For every 10 minutes late on Sunday, 20 points will be deducted from your score, up to 1 hour. After that, your team will be disqualified. 2) No caged or European hunts allowed. PROTESTS: Only participants and benefit directors have the right to file protest. Protests must be filed in writing with a benefit director no later than 30 minutes of the final check in of benefit. Protests will be reviewed by benefit directors and any teams found violating the rules will be immediately disqualified and the reasons for disqualification and team names will be announced during the banquet. REMINDER: THIS IS A CHARITY EVENT!!! CANCELLATION POLICY: In the event of dangerous weather, cancellation of all or part of the event will be at the discretion of the benefit directors. In case of cancellation, entry fees will be donated to the following charities: The Beau Arndt “Love of the Outdoors” Scholarship at Emporia State University, the local Emporia Food Bank, and The Salvation Army, and Camp Alexander. There will be no make-up date. MISCELLANEOUS INFORMATION: This benefit is unique in the fact that all game are donated to The Salvation Army to help feed the hungry.
